(INDIANAPOLIS) – Expectations will be high in Osgood and Oldenburg this season. 

The Indiana Soccer Coaches Association announced Monday its Preseason High School Boys Soccer Polls.

Jac-Cen-Del and Oldenburg Academy made the Top 20 in Class 1A with the Eagles ranked #4 followed by Oldenburg Academy at #15.

Last season, Jac-Cen-Del went 16-4-1 on their way to winning the ORVC and a sectional championship. The Eagles would advance to the Final 8, where they lost to eventual state champion Providence by a score of 3-2.

Jac-Cen-Del was led by Jacob Jines a season ago. As a senior, Jines scored 31 goals and added 21 assists. Fellow senior Jordan Meyer added 14 goals and nine assists.

Their top returning goal scorers are Yuki Casado (14) and Ryan Wilson (8). The Eagles also return their top goalkeeper in senior Nathan Hoffman.

As for Oldenburg Academy, the Twisters went 10-7-2 in 2020. Their season ended in the sectional championship with a 2-0 loss to Southwestern (Shelbyville).
